To evaluate the effects of planned training on the organism and perform a optimal functional diagnosis of each athlete It is necessary to plan and perform adequate laboratory and field tests, as well as the periodic analysis of its results, which become a useful tool for dosing training loads
A descriptive, longitudinal and prospective study was performed with the application of a pretest and posttest to in a group of athletes, consisting of a test of effort in the treadmill, carried out in two moments of the Macrocycle of training, beginning and end of the general physical preparation.
Male athletes of judo of the sports school in Granma were studied, the research allowed to evaluate the functional capacity of these athletes through the determination of physiological variables, in the laboratory condition; essential information for effective planning of the training of these athletes with Vista to his participation in the national games.
To do this, the theoretical level methods are applied: historical-logical, analytic-synthetic, inductive-deductive, hypothetical-deductive, and empirical: interview, structured observation, exercise and criteria of specialists, the statistical level of frequencies absolute and relative. Finally, an adequate, functional and efficient evaluation has been carried out and an efficient medical control obtaining better results in juvenile athletes of Judo of the sports school in Granma
